A state appellate court Friday rejected Los Angeles attorney Gloria Allred's attempt to have a financial guardian appointed for Nadya Suleman's octuplets. "This is an unprecedented, meritless effort by a stranger to a family to seek appointment of a guardian of the estates of the minor children," wrote Justice Richard D.
